Output 59bbf321a65cfad77c4ea895cba3cc32c163120dd46bc95afc5db8f2a2bf1108:10

value
16807513
script pubkey
OP_0 OP_PUSHBYTES_20 27e4a9c857f3d7fa8cea875c8a5df86bbbe1fa77
address
bc1qylj2njzh70tl4r82sawg5h0cdwa7r7nhkewl84
transaction
59bbf321a65cfad77c4ea895cba3cc32c163120dd46bc95afc5db8f2a2bf1108
spent
true